A concept that struck my interest in this week’s reading was Mead’s thoughts of human interaction involving significant symbols. Simply put, these symbols initially have to have direct meaning and that meaning must be shared within some group of individuals. An example provided in the text is words turned into phrases or gestures such as handshakes or applauses. These symbols come to be through interaction which is how the significance of the symbol is met.  With this background information, I began thinking of personal experiences within these symbols. I was doing my reading at a local coffee shop and as I was reading, I noticed employees putting chairs on top of tables and sweeping the floor. As soon as I witnessed this, I realized the shop was closing and I should pack up my stuff and leave. This is a prime example of a significant symbol in the form of a gesture. This experience made me realize how often we use or interpret significant symbols to communicate, whether it is directly or indirectly. One concept that really stood out to me was when the chapter was comparing Mead’s version and Cooly’s version. They are in a sense very similar observations — Cooley first coined the term looking – glass self and I feel like Mead went more in-depth with that perspective by explaining the concept of self through Me and I. Mead explains it by seeing oneself as an object — and that it is the capacity to be self-aware. From that view point you are able to see ”their” perspective and he states that when we adopt their perspective, we are able to see ourselves as an object and we develop self-awareness. In Cooley’s contributions, he spoke about primary and secondary groups with who we interact. It mentions the differences between the two. For example, my primary group would include my family such as my mom, dad, sister, and grandma, etc. and my friends. These are people who I communicate with, have a strong bond, and we hang out. An example of my second group would be co-workers, bosses, classmates. This is because our relationship is more formal and less intimate.
